Transaction 8fc1c681a290fc07130af08a099c56aaed018c2ee7846ee4c4deb2b446726350
1 Input
1 Output
-
8fc1c681a290fc07130af08a099c56aaed018c2ee7846ee4c4deb2b446726350:0
- value
- 907543
- script pubkey
- OP_0 OP_PUSHBYTES_20 edc2063439d8b1d5e485cadee7fe30abada3ed0d
- address
- bc1qahpqvdpemzcatey9et0w0l3s4wk68mgdr6derq